The T-Cell Immunotherapy market is a dynamic and rapidly evolving sector within the broader landscape of cancer treatment, characterized by its innovative approaches to harnessing the body's immune system for combating cancerous cells. This therapeutic strategy focuses on modifying T-cells, a type of white blood cell, to enhance their ability to recognize and destroy tumors, thus offering significant promise in the fight against various cancers. As this market continues to mature, its relevance extends beyond oncology to other therapeutic areas, attracting considerable attention for its potential implications in treating autoimmune disorders and viral infections. A significant challenge within the T-Cell Immunotherapy market is the variability in patient responses to treatments. While some individuals exhibit remarkable improvements, others experience minimal or no therapeutic effect, leading to concerns about the predictability and reliability of these therapies. Additionally, the complexity of designing and producing personalized T-cell therapies can be daunting, resulting in delayed treatment timelines and increased costs. This unpredictability not only impacts patient outcomes but also raises concerns among investors regarding the sustainability of current development models in a market where high expectations are set.
To address these challenges, the industry has pivoted towards the development of combined therapies and biomarker-driven patient selection. By integrating T-cell therapies with established treatment modalities such as chemotherapy and radiation, clinicians can enhance overall efficacy and tailor approaches based on biomarker presence, ensuring appropriate patients receive suitable therapies. This solution not only aims to mitigate variability in responses but also optimizes the therapeutic regimen, ultimately improving treatment success rates.
